Canada Agile IoT Market Overview
As per MRFR analysis, the Canada Agile IoT Market Size was estimated at 3 (USD Billion) in 2023. The Canada Agile IoT Market is expected to grow from 3.54(USD Billion) in 2024 to 22.17 (USD Billion) by 2035. The Canada Agile IoT Market CAGR (growth rate) is expected to be around 18.153% during the forecast period (2025 - 2035)

Canada Agile IoT Market Drivers
Increasing Demand for Smart Cities
The push towards smart cities in Canada is a significant driver for the Canada Agile IoT Market. The Canadian government has shown commitment to developing smart city initiatives, which include the integration of Internet of Things (IoT) technologies for enhancing urban living conditions. According to the Government of Canada, smart city development is expected to mobilize investments reaching CAD 1.9 billion in urban infrastructure by 2025, significantly impacting local economies and quality of life.
Major organizations such as the Canadian Smart Cities Network are promoting the use of IoT for traffic management and environmental monitoring, providing a conducive environment for Agile IoT solutions. This holistic development strategy supports sustainable urban growth and improves service delivery, further propelling the demand for Agile IoT solutions across various sectors.
Advancements in Connectivity Technologies
The advancements in connectivity technologies such as 5G and Low Power Wide Area Networks (LPWAN) are vital driving factors in the Canada Agile IoT Market. The Canadian Radio-television and Telecommunications Commission (CRTC) reports that Canada is rapidly expanding its 5G network, which is expected to cover 90% of the population by 2026.
Such advancements provide faster, more efficient communication channels for IoT devices, facilitating growth in Agile IoT deployments.Companies like Rogers Communications and Bell Canada are investing heavily in these technologies, fostering a strong ecosystem for IoT applications, which enhances real-time data utilization for businesses and public infrastructure.
Government Initiatives on Digital Transformation
The Canadian government's focus on digital transformation acts as a major catalyst for the Canada Agile IoT Market. The Digital Operations Strategic Plan lays out a vision for 2023, which aims to incorporate IoT technologies into public services, leading to a significant optimization of resource management and service delivery.
An investment of CAD 1.7 billion has been earmarked for digital identity initiatives by the Government of Canada, showcasing a strong commitment to fostering an Agile IoT ecosystem.This dynamic approach promotes innovation across sectors such as healthcare, transportation, and public safety, significantly enhancing the demand for efficient Agile IoT solutions.
Growth in Industrial IoT Applications
The expansion of Industrial Internet of Things (IIoT) applications is another strong driver contributing to the growth of the Canada Agile IoT Market. A report from Statistics Canada indicates that manufacturing alone accounts for 10% of the nation's GDP, with significant opportunities for IoT integration to enhance productivity and operational efficiency.
Major players like Siemens Canada are investing in smart manufacturing technologies, which utilize IoT solutions to monitor production lines and manage supply chains in real time.Such advancements not only improve overall operational efficiency but also cater to the growing demand for agile frameworks in industries, facilitating a robust environment for the Agile IoT market.

Agile IoT Market Deployment Insights
The Deployment segment of the Canada Agile IoT Market encompasses various methodologies utilized for implementing IoT solutions, primarily focusing on On-premises and Cloud options. The On-premises deployment model provides organizations with greater control over their data and infrastructure, which is critical for industries that prioritize security and compliance, such as healthcare and finance. Conversely, the Cloud deployment model has gained substantial traction due to its scalability and reduced upfront costs, allowing businesses of varying sizes to leverage advanced IoT capabilities without extensive initial investment.
In Canada, the government has been actively promoting digital transformation initiatives, further driving the adoption of cloud-based solutions in various sectors. The ongoing evolution towards a more interconnected and responsive economy emphasizes the need for flexible deployment strategies, helping organizations address dynamic market requirements effectively. Both deployment approaches contribute to optimizing operational efficiencies, enhancing user experiences, and leveraging substantial amounts of Canada Agile IoT Market data for informed decision-making in an increasingly competitive landscape.

Agile IoT Market Connectivity Insights
The Connectivity segment in the Canada Agile IoT Market plays a crucial role in the overall advancement of Internet of Things applications, enhancing the interconnectivity of devices across various sectors. As Canada experiences a digital transformation, there is a growing emphasis on reliable and efficient connectivity solutions. LAN technology is pivotal in enterprises that require high-speed and low-latency connections within localized environments, facilitating seamless data transfer. Wi-Fi remains fundamental, evolving with new standards that support an increasing number of devices and enhance user experience, which is particularly significant as smart homes become more prevalent across the nation.
Additionally, Li-Fi, utilizing light communication, is emerging as a notable alternative, especially in environments where radio frequency signals are restricted, offering potentially faster speeds and enhanced security. This segment's growth is driven by increasing demand for smart devices, advancements in communication technologies, and the need for connectivity that meets the standards of modern applications and user expectations. Moreover, government initiatives supporting IoT infrastructure further bolster this segment's development, making Canada a key player in the global Agile IoT landscape.

Canada Agile IoT Market Developments
In recent developments within the Canada Agile IoT Market, companies like Hewlett Packard Enterprise, Intel, and BlackBerry continue to expand their IoT solutions tailored for various sectors, including healthcare and agriculture. For instance, Telus and Bell Canada are investing heavily in 5G infrastructure to enhance IoT connectivity and services, significantly impacting efficiency across industries. In July 2023, Cisco Systems announced a partnership with several Canadian municipalities to improve smart city initiatives, showcasing the growing focus on urban IoT solutions. Additionally, Oracle and IBM are enhancing their cloud capabilities, providing Canadian businesses with advanced IoT data analytics.
Notably, in August 2023, Rogers Communications announced an acquisition aimed at bolstering its position in the IoT space, aligning with broader trends of consolidation in the market. Growth in this sector is notable, with a projected increase in market valuation attributed to rising demand for IoT devices and solutions, fostering innovation and efficiency. Furthermore, Zebra Technologies and Amazon Web Services are collaborating on logistics and supply chain solutions, emphasizing the integration of IoT with existing operational frameworks in Canada.
